【Linux】学习-02-Linux基础命令
注意:Linux下,所有的命令可以组合使用,如以下的【ls -al】,就是【ls -a】和【ls -l】的组合
ls :显示文件夹下的内容 ls -a :显示文件夹下的全部文件,包括隐藏文件 ls -l :以竖列表的形式显示文件夹下的内容
ls -al :显示文件夹下的全部文件的完整信息
ll : 等价于 ls -l命令
cd .. : 返回上级目录 (英文全拼 change directory)
cd / : 返回根目录
cd :返回root目录下,等同于【cd ~】
cd /usr/local :前面的第一个斜杠是绝对路径的意思,也就是从最外边的那个目录进入
cd usr/local : 可以注意到这个没有带第一个斜杠,这是相对路径的意思,你必须保证当前所在的目录下有 usr/local文件夹
pwd : 查看当前用户所在的目录(英文全拼:print work directory)
clear : 清空当前界面内容,实际是将内容隐藏到上一页
mkdir test : 创建名为【test】的文件夹
mkdir -p test2/test3/test4 : 递归创建多级文件夹 【test2/test3/test4】
【以下4个删除命令极其危险,高危操作,谨慎执行】
rmdir test :删除【test】文件夹
rmdir -p test2/test3/test4 :删除多级目录
rm -f test.txt :删除【test.txt】文件 ,f 表示强制删除,不会出现警告
rm -r test2 : 递归删除 【test2】下的所有东西
mv test.txt test2 : 将test.txt文件移动到test2文件夹下
mv test2 test6 : 将文件夹【test2】重命名为【test6】
ifconfig :查看网络的配置
chmod :更改文件的9个属性
cat : 查看文件内容
tac : 从尾部开始显示文件内容(cat倒过来)
nl :查看文件内容,并显示行号
more : 以分页的形式查看文件,按空格键翻页
less : 以分页的形式从文件尾部查看文件,按空格或翻页键翻页
(最后需要按【q】键退出;如果要查找内容,用【/内容】即可;如果想想向上查找,用【?内容】即可;
查找到内容后,用【n】查找下一个,用【N】查找上一个)
head -n: 只看文件的前面【n】行内容
tail -n: 只查看文件的最后面【n】行内容
Vim 编辑器
vim a.txt :编辑文件。如果文件不存在,则会新建文件
:wq :保存并退出
:w :保存文件
:q :仅仅是退出
:q! :强制退出(叹号是强制执行的意思)
:set nu :显示行号
[ 版权声明 ]:
本文所有权归作者本人,文中参考的部分已经做了标记!
商业用途转载请联系作者授权!
非商业用途转载,请标明本文链接及出处!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构